Here's what we recommend:
- Each committee presentation should be 10-15 minutes long. This is not very long, so keep to the point. Focus on what that committee needs to hear.
- Each slide should only have 3 or 4 bullets
- Some of the committee rooms are really small so try to keep it to 4-6 students per presentation.
- Break up the talking points so that sucessive slides alternate speakers.
- Dress as you feel appropriate for this meeting.
- Allow time at the end for questions.
- If you're asked a question and you don't know: don't bullshit. Say we don't know and "good question, if you want we can research that".
